Job Summary

Under general supervision, Investor Transition Solutions, a specialized department at the Raymond James home office, is dedicated to providing exceptional service to Raymond James’ clients. Although we operate as a home office department, our approach mirrors that of most Raymond James branches. Your expertise in customer service, securities trading, and problem-solving will enable you to deliver superior service to our valued clients. At Investor Transition Solutions, you will not have a sales goal rather we want you to focus on delivering a Service 1st client experience. Extensive contact with clients via phone.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Service 1st Client Experience: Address account-level issues through inbound phone calls, ensuring a positive client experience.

  • Provide a positive client experience to clients who contact Investment Central through inbound and outbound phone calls and electronic communications.

  • Collaboration: Work closely with other home office departments to resolve client account issues.

  • Proactive Client Communication: Reach out to clients proactively to address important matters related to their accounts and to follow up on other items.

  • Trade Execution: Execute client-directed trades across various asset types, including mutual funds, fixed income, and stocks.

  • Transaction Processing: Regularly handle client-directed transactions such as ACH transfers, wire transactions, and journal requests.

  • Account Variety: Manage a diverse range of accounts, including trust accounts, estate accounts, and entity accounts.

  • Executes trades based on verbal instructions.

  • Performs Mass Moves (entire book of business transfers) for Transitioning and Terminated Financial Advisors.

  •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

Educational/Previous Experience Requirements

  • High School Diploma or equivalent and three (3) years experience in the financial services industry, preferably including related service experience.

  • Associates and/or Bachelor’s Degree Preferred but not required.

  • OR ~

  • An equivalent combination of experience, education, and/or training as approved by Human Resources.

Licenses/Certifications

  • SIE required provided that an exemption or grandfathering cannot be applied.

  • Series 7 and 63 licenses required.

Raymond James is a diversified financial services company that provides an array of investment banking, asset management, and brokerage services. Established in 1962, it has grown to be a leading player in the financial industry, offering a full suite of financial services to individuals, corporations, and institutional clients.
